Create11 Festival in East London
The annual Create festival takes place in East London's Olympic host boroughs, where more than 12,000 artists live and work.
This year's festival events include exhibitions, live music, outdoor cinema, nocturnal walks, rooftop farming, underground readings, craft workshops, secret parties and pop-up restaurants.

Tracey Emin - Love is What You Want a retrospective exhibition at the Hayward Gallery
18th May – 29th August 2011
Tracey Emin - Love Is What You Want a retrospective exhibition at the Haywood Gallery
The exhibition Love Is What You Want is a major survey covering every period of her career, revealing facets of the artist and her work that are often overlooked. The exhibition features painting, drawing, photography, textiles, video and sculp...
